10/(c) Megan Johnson

  • Position Forward
  • Height 5-5
  • Class Senior
  • Highschool Memorial HS
  • Hometown Madison, Wis.

Biography

Parents: Mark and Leslie Johnson
Major: Mathematics
Minor: Physics and MIS

2018-19 Golf: Fall: Competed in four tournaments with a stroke average of 105.3.

2018-19 Hockey: Played in 24 games... Finished third on the team in assists with 10... Recorded five goals including one power play goal and one game winning goal... Received MIAC All-Conference honors... Received the Sheila Brown Award... Named MIAC Athlete of the Week and to the D3hockey.com Team of the Week once.

2017-18 Hockey: Played in 26 games... Finishes tied for first on the team in goals with nine... Finished second on the team in power play goals with three and game winning goals with two... Finished fourth on the team in assists with seven.

2016-17 Hockey: Played in all 27 games... Recorded 10 points and four assists... Recorded 16 blocks... Named winner of the Minnesota Intercollegiate Athletic Conference Elite 22 award for academic excellence.

2015-16 Hockey: Played in all 26 games... Recorded 11 goals and seven assists... Tied for first on the team in goals with 11, power play goals with three, shorthanded goals with one and game winning goals with three... Recorded seven assists... Received All-MIAC Honorable Mention... Named Female Rookie of the Year at Augsburg.

High School: Played Tennis and Soccer at James Madison Memorial HS... MVP for tennis...Two-time double state champion for tennis.
